🚇 🗺️ Getting There
The Trent Building is located on the University of Nottingham's main Park Campus. You can reach it via public transport with several bus routes serving the campus. If driving, there is limited visitor parking available, so checking campus parking regulations beforehand is advised.
Yes, Nottingham Trent University (NTU) is well-served by public transport. Numerous bus routes connect the city center and surrounding areas to its campuses.
The University Park campus is quite large, so walking is common. Cycling is also a popular option for students. For those unfamiliar, campus maps are readily available online or at information points.
The Trent Building is an active part of the University of Nottingham. While you can admire its exterior and explore the public areas of the campus, access to specific internal departments or offices may require an appointment or be part of a guided tour.
During freshers' week, expect increased traffic and public transport usage. It's advisable to allow extra travel time and consider using public transport or ride-sharing services to avoid parking challenges.
🎫 🎫 Tickets & Entry
No, general access to the exterior of the Trent Building and the University Park campus grounds is free. However, specific events or tours held within the building might require tickets or prior booking.
As an active university building, the Trent Building's internal access hours vary depending on the academic schedule and specific departmental functions. The campus grounds are generally accessible during daylight hours.
The University of Nottingham often offers campus tours, especially for prospective students. It's best to check the official University of Nottingham website for current tour schedules and booking information.
There is no entrance fee to visit the University Park campus. You are welcome to explore the grounds and admire the architecture.

The Architectural Significance of the Trent Building
Constructed in the early 20th century, the Trent Building has witnessed decades of academic evolution. It houses key administrative offices and lecture halls, serving as a functional hub while maintaining its iconic status. The surrounding University Park Campus is equally renowned for its beautiful landscaping, featuring a picturesque lake and mature trees, creating an idyllic environment for study and reflection.
Many visitors and students express a strong fondness for the Trent Building, often referring to it as their 'favourite building' on campus. Its enduring appeal lies in its blend of historical charm and its role as an active, integral part of university life. The impressive drone footage available online further highlights its grandeur and the beauty of its setting.
